2 Timothy 4:2
Preach the word; be prepared in season and out of season; correct, rebuke and encourage-with great patience and careful instruction. 2 Timothy 4:2
This verse speaks of the great essentials that must be carried on to fulfill the prayer of our Lord and to advance the kingdom of God and bring to fulfillment the amazing work that began by His first appearing upon the earth. When we read the phrase "preach the Word," most of us think that this is addressed to preachers like me, that one has to do this in church, on a platform, or behind a pulpit.
These verses are not addressed to preachers only. They Include all the people of God. In today's relative world when absolute truth is being refuted on all sides and the Word of God is treated with derision by both secular as well as religious 'authorities’, we need to pin our colors to the mast of our lives and be ready, at all times and in every place, to preach the Word.
Whether convenient or not, in season and out of season, we should be ready and prepared to patiently preach the truth of scripture, not only with our words but in our lives. Not only with our actions but with our attitudes. Not only in our behavior but in the hidden motives that rule our thinking. To preach the truth in love may require us to patiently and compassionately correct a brother or sister who has been led astray from the Word of truth.
It may require us to follow scriptural guidelines to rebuke or challenge a person or ministry, but any admonishment should never be aggressively or deliberately confrontational. Preaching the Word is often to encourage and exhort the body of Christ as we watch and wait for the any-day return of the Lord Jesus for His church, but it should always reflect Christ's gracious character.
To preach the Word does not mean to teach others what you think it says, what you would like it to say, or what others conclude that it says. It means to preach what God literally says in His Word, in the context in which it is written without seeking to allegorize the scripture or read an alternative meaning into the Word. God has spoken in His Word, and we would do well to take note of what He says. Then we truly will be equipped to live out these verses!!!
